The formation constant, Kf, of PbCl42-(aq), Pb2+(aq) + 4 Cl-(aq) ⇌ PbCl42-(aq), is 2.5 x 1015. What are the equilibrium concentrations of Pb2+(aq), Cl-(aq), and PbCl42-(aq) if we add 0.123 mol of Pb(NO3)2 to 1.000 L of a 0.802 M aqueous solution of NaCl? Assume the volume remains fixed at 1.000 L.
